Larry, Camille, and Simone are keeping track of how far they walk each day. At the end of the week they combined their distances
solniwko [45]

The distance walked by Larry is 9 miles and Camille is 18 miles and Simone is 7 miles

<em><u>Solution:</u></em>

Let "x" be the distance walked by Larry

Let "y" be the distance walked by Camille

Let "z" be the distance walked by Simone

<em><u>At the end of the week they combined their distances and found that they walked 34 miles in total</u></em>

Total distance = 34 miles

Therefore, we can say,

x + y + z = 34 ---------- eqn 1

<em><u>Camille walked twice as far as Larry</u></em>

distance walked by Camille = 2(distance walked by Larry)

y = 2x ---------- eqn 2

<em><u>Larry walked 2 more miles than Simone</u></em>

distance walked by Larry = 2 + distance walked by Simone

x = 2 + z

z = x - 2 ------- eqn 3

<em><u>Substitute eqn 2 and eqn 3 in eqn 1</u></em>

x + 2x + x - 2 = 34

4x - 2 = 34

4x = 34 + 2

4x = 36

<h3>x = 9</h3>

<em><u>Substitute x = 9 in eqn 2</u></em>

y = 2(9) = 18

<h3>y = 18</h3>

<em><u>Substitute x = 9 in eqn 3</u></em>

z = 9 - 2

<h3>z = 7</h3>

Thus distance walked by Larry is 9 miles and Camille is 18 miles and Simone is 7 miles

Lamont works for an electric utility and is installing a 40 foot utility pole as shown. Lamont drills the anchor of a support ca
PIT_PIT [208]

Answer:

<em>Approximately 43 feet of minimum cable is needed. </em>

Step-by-step explanation:

This problem can be solved using Trigonometry and Pythagorean theorem. Pythagorean theorem applies on right-triangles (<em>which are known to have one 90° angle</em>). The theorem states that the square of the Hypotenuse is obtained by the squared sum of the other two sides of the triangle (i.e the two sides forming the 90° angle - with the hypotenuse side being across it as:

h^2=a^2+b^2           Eqn. (1)

where

h is the hypotenuse

a is a side

b is a side

<u>Now in this case, the utility pole must be perpendicular to the ground and the anchor being parallel to the ground, and a 90° angle formed between them. </u>Conclusively the cable length will be represented by the hypotenuse in a right triangle. So here we have a=40ft and b=15ft. Plugging in Eqn.(1) and solving for h we have:

h^2=40^2+15^2\\h=\sqrt{40^2+15^2} \\h=\sqrt{1600+225}\\ h=\sqrt{1825}\\ h=5\sqrt{73}\\ h=42.72ft

So we conclude that the minimum length of cable needed by Lamont is

≈43 feet (rounded up).
